Cursusaanbod

Inleiding tot Backendontwikkeling

Begrijpen hoe websites en webtoepassingen werken

Pythonpakketten en -bibliotheken installeren

Uw backend-ontwikkelomgeving voorbereiden

Het verschil begrijpen tussen de presentatielaag (frontend) en de serverside (backend) van een webtoepassing

Python basisbeginselen

Databases en SQL basisbeginselen

Linux basisbeginselen

Een ontwikkelkader kiezen

Een webapplicatieserver inrichten (LAMP Stack)

Meting gebruikersinput afhandelen

Uitvoer genereren

 Sjablonen gebruiken om de uitvoer te standaardiseren

Een verbinding met een database maken

Gebruikers inschrijven via de toepassing mogelijk maken

De webtoepassing beveiligen

De webtoepassing testen

Het project beheren met versiebeheer

De toepassing uitbreiden met geavanceerde Pythonfunctionaliteit

Werken met een NoSQL-database

Implementatietechnieken en continue integratie

Toepassingsprestaties monitoren

De webtoepassing optimaliseren

Een webtoepassing schalen

Problemen oplossen

Samenvatting en conclusie

Vereisten

  • Python programmeerervaring

Doelgroep

  • Ontwikkelaars
 35 Uren

Aantal deelnemers


Prijs Per Deelnemer

Getuigenissen (5)

Voorlopige Aankomende Cursussen

Gerelateerde categorieën